在Python中使用Matplotlib绘制简单的折线图
发布时间:2024-01-12 10:54:21
在Python中,我们可以使用Matplotlib库来绘制各种类型的图表,包括折线图。折线图是一种显示数据随时间变化的趋势的图表,通常用于展示连续数据的变化。
下面是一个简单的例子,展示如何使用Matplotlib库在Python中绘制一个简单的折线图。
首先,我们需要安装Matplotlib库,可以使用pip命令来进行安装:
pip install matplotlib
在这个例子中,我们将绘制一个某月份销售额的折线图。假设我们有以下销售额数据:
月份 | 销售额
-------------|-------
1月份 | 1000
2月份 | 1500
3月份 | 1200
4月份 | 1800
5月份 | 2000
我们将使用Matplotlib来绘制这些数据的折线图。下面是完整的代码示例:
import matplotlib.pyplot as plt
# 假设我们的数据存在两个列表中
months = [1, 2, 3, 4, 5]
sales = [1000, 1500, 1200, 1800, 2000]
# 创建折线图
plt.plot(months, sales)
# 设置图表的标题和坐标轴标签
plt.title("Monthly Sales")
plt.xlabel("Months")
plt.ylabel("Sales")
# 显示图表
plt.show()
在这个例子中,我们首先导入了Matplotlib库,并且创建了两个列表,分别表示月份和销售额数据。然后,我们使用plt.plot函数创建了折线图,将月份作为横坐标,销售额作为纵坐标。接着,我们使用plt.title、plt.xlabel和plt.ylabel函数分别设置了图表的标题、横坐标和纵坐标的标签。最后,我们使用plt.show函数显示了图表。
运行这段代码,就可以在Python中绘制出一个简单的折线图,展示了销售额随时间变化的趋势。
通过这个例子,你可以看到Matplotlib库是非常强大和灵活的,可以帮助我们在Python中绘制出各种类型的图表,包括折线图。你可以根据自己的需求和数据来调整代码,创建属于自己的折线图。同时,Matplotlib还提供了丰富的图表定制选项,可以帮助你创建出更加美观和易读的图表。
